Breaking Down the Fundamentals

To master the art, it's essential to start with the basics:

  • This includes understanding the fundamentals of drawing, such as perspective, proportion, and line work.
  • Familiarizing yourself with the unique characteristics of Jack Russell Terriers, including their coat patterns, ear shapes, and body language.
  • Developing a keen eye for detail and a willingness to experiment with different techniques and mediums.

Step 1: Observing and Capturing the Spirit of Your Subject

This involves studying the behavior, body language, and emotions of your Jack Russell Terrier models, as well as developing a keen sense of observation to capture their unique personalities.

Step 2: Mastering the Art of Proportion and Measurement

This step requires a deep understanding of the principles of proportion, measurement, and placement, as well as the ability to translate these concepts into visual reality.

Step 3: Bringing It All Together with Composition and Expression

This final step involves synthesizing all your knowledge and skills to create a cohesive, engaging piece of art that showcases your subject in all its glory.
